
Backstage + AI: Stop Hunting for AI Assets
If you're working in an engineering org that uses Backstage , you already know the "Golden Path" philosophy: everything you need — infra, docs, services — lives in one unified catalog. Backstage solved the microservices mess, but now we're facing a new kind of chaos: AI fragmentation . The Problem: "Where Did Team B Save That Agent?" Right now, nearly every squad is busy spinning up their own GitHub Copilot instructions and specialized agents. The catch? All that institutional knowledge ends up trapped in siloed .md files or buried in some obscure repo. When you switch projects or need to follow an architecture standard another team has already figured out, you inevitably reinvent the wheel . Squad Silos — Two teams writing the same instructions for the same stack. Zero Visibility — No way to know an agent already exists to automate that tedious internal process.
